Job Description
Performing architectural/engineering calculations. Preparing specifications, reports and related data tables. Maintaining liaison with design and drafting groups. Preparing, reviewing, and approving drawings as required. Under the direction of the Supervising Architect, may independently perform advanced technical assignments of various complexities within approved schedules and budgets. May coordinate technical and administrative activities with employees in other disciplines and other departments participating on an assigned project. May review and approve conceptual designs. May assist in the development of new architectural methods and techniques. BIM Model and Drawing production. Design brief compliance, completeness and accuracy. Design coordination within interior design and cross discipline. Initiates and develops design and construction document drawings through completion in conformance with project requirements, applicable codes and design criteria established by project leadership. Preparing, reviewing and approving drawings as required. Basic knowledge of design, trends, construction methodology, materials application and manufacturer supplier appropriateness. Designs creative and innovative interior environments that support our client needs in collaboration with other disciplines.
Qualifications
Minimum Requirements Very good knowledge of English and Polish. University degree in Architecture. Minimum 5 years post undergraduate experience. Proven related professional experience in an Architectural or Interior design practice. Software proficiency with Revit, AutoCAD and Adobe. Experience in all project phases from predesign through project closeout. Experience with international clients or with international companies.
